1
Weld Output Cable
Determine total cable length in weld
circuit and maximum welding am-
peres. Use Section 3-3 to select
proper cable size.
Use shortest cables possible.
Do not use damaged cables.
2
Terminal Lug
Use lugs of proper amperage ca-
pacity and hole size for connecting
to work clamp, electrode holder, or
wire feeder.
3
Insulated Electrode Holder
Install according to manufacturer's
instructions.
4
Work Clamp
Install onto work cable.
5
Dinse-Type Connector
Install onto weld cable.
